The Complex
by J. Rudolph
Part 1 of the Reanimates series
Neighbors in an apartment complex must band together to survive a zombie plague in this post-apocalyptic horror series opener.
Cali Anglin, RN, had a great life. It may have been nothing special to the rest of the world, but she loved it.
That was on a Wednesday.
By Friday, it was gone forever.
With the government gone, electricity extinguished, and the food supply dwindling, she must face questions she's never asked herself before-just how far would she go to save her family, her friends, and her rapidly collapsing community? Would she kill for them? Would she die for them?
She's about to find out...

The Highway
by J. Rudolph
Part 2 of the Reanimates series
Survivors of a zombie apocalypse flee their homes, but their journey to safety is riddled with terror in this chilling sequel to The Complex.
The Complex is in ruins. The zombies are everywhere.
Cali Anglin and the other survivors have one slim hope: sanctuary in Idaho, thousands of miles away. They must take to the Highway-Interstate 15, the only path to safety. Their trek across a devastated America is one horror stacked on another, constantly pursued by the hungry dead.
They must ask themselves: How much would you pay to begin again?

The Escape
by J. Rudolph
Part 3 of the Reanimates series
A chance at freedom from zombies forces an American nurse and her family to consider a deadly journey in this horrifying sequel to The Highway.
When the world ends, what will you fight for?
As the zombie apocalypse rages on, Cali and her family find refuge in Idaho... but it's not enough. She knows the ugly truth: hand-to-mouth, hardscrabble "survival" is just slow suicide. If they hope to live, really live, her family, her friends, her community must thrive.
At first a small town in Montana, hundreds of miles away, looks like the answer. Then Cali receives a message of hope from an unlikely source, telling them about Ireland: a safe zone, free from the undead. She and her allies must make an impossible decision: do they risk their lives crossing the country-and the Atlantic Ocean-to reach a zombie-free home, or do they stay put and make the best with what they have?
With the undead attacking from every side... how far will they go to feel truly alive once more?

The Long Road
by J. Rudolph
Part 4 of the Reanimates series
A young man fights his way across a zombie-ridden America to save the last of his family in this post-apocalyptic sequel to The Escape.
Years after his trans-Atlantic journey from America to Ireland, Drew returns to the States with a dark truth: The Emerald Isle has already fallen into a dictatorship that runs on slavery and fear.
Now, Drew must fight his way across a fatally-infected New York and the remains of civilization itself to find and warn the last of his people-don't go. There is no escape to Ireland. Their hell is worse than ours...
The Long Road is two stories in one-Drew's travels to Montana to save the last people in the world that matter, punctuated by the vivid, violent memories of Ireland and what humans can do to each other, when the world collapses around them.
All is not lost, but Drew brings with him a bitter message: When your last hope is stolen from you... it's time to build hope, all your own.

The Rise
by J. Rudolph
Part 5 of the Reanimates series
A Montana town searches for strength amid the dangers following the zombie apocalypse in this sequel to The Long Road.
Community- it's the reason the survivors have made it through the carnage and mayhem of the apocalypse. It is the source of their strength... until a message from the stars divides them.
With half of the group off to Ireland in search of greener pastures, the remaining survivors gamble on whether they will be strong enough to make Wilsall rise.
The road so far has not been without its stumbles, and more than a few enemies have been made. Many of the group are left with festering wounds, and only time will tell whether they can heal. Will community be enough to keep these survivors on their feet? The future of Wilsall rests on their shoulders.
